Ingredients for Cucumber Sweet Pepper Salad

Now that I’ve whetted your appetite with the delightful memories tied to my Cucumber Sweet Pepper Salad, let’s talk about the ingredients that make this dish shine. The beauty of this salad lies in its fresh, vibrant components. Each ingredient plays a role, contributing to the overall flavor and texture. Here’s what you’ll need:

Main Ingredients

  • 2 medium cucumbers, peeled and diced
  • 1 large sweet bell pepper (red, yellow, or orange), chopped
  • 1 small red onion, finely sliced
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1/4 cup feta cheese, crumbled (optional)

When selecting your cucumbers, I recommend going for firm ones with smooth skin. They should feel heavy for their size, which indicates juiciness. As for the sweet peppers, I love using a mix of colors to make the salad visually appealing. The sweetness of the peppers balances perfectly with the crispness of the cucumbers.

How to Prepare Cucumber Sweet Pepper Salad

Now that we have all our vibrant ingredients ready, it’s time to bring them together in a delightful Cucumber Sweet Pepper Salad. I find that the preparation process is just as enjoyable as the final dish. The colors, the textures, and the aromas all come together to create a beautiful medley. Let’s dive into the steps!

Step 1: Prepare the Vegetables

First things first, we need to get our vegetables ready. Start by washing the cucumbers and sweet peppers under cool running water. I like to peel the cucumbers, but if you prefer the extra crunch and nutrients, feel free to leave the skin on. Next, dice the cucumbers into bite-sized pieces. For the sweet pepper, remove the seeds and chop it into small chunks. Finally, slice the red onion thinly and halve the cherry tomatoes. The more colorful your salad, the more inviting it will be!

Tips for Step 1

  • Use a sharp knife for clean cuts; it makes a difference in presentation.
  • To reduce the sharpness of the onion, soak the slices in cold water for a few minutes before adding them to the salad.

Step 2: Make the Dressing

Now, let’s whip up a simple dressing that will tie all the flavors together. In a small bowl, combine 3 tablespoons of olive oil, 2 tablespoons of red wine vinegar, and a pinch of salt and pepper. If you’re feeling adventurous, add a teaspoon of honey for a touch of sweetness or a sprinkle of dried herbs for extra flavor. Whisk everything together until it’s well blended. The dressing should be light and refreshing, complementing the crispness of the vegetables.

Tips for Step 2

  • Always taste your dressing before adding it to the salad. Adjust the seasoning to your liking!
  • If you prefer a creamier dressing, consider adding a dollop of Greek yogurt or sour cream.

Step 3: Combine Ingredients

With our vegetables prepped and dressing ready, it’s time to combine everything! In a large mixing bowl, add the diced cucumbers, chopped sweet pepper, sliced onion, halved cherry tomatoes, and chopped parsley. Pour the dressing over the top and gently toss everything together until the vegetables are well coated. If you’re using feta cheese, sprinkle it on top just before serving for a beautiful finish.

Tips for Step 3

  • Be gentle when tossing the salad to avoid bruising the vegetables.
  • Let the salad sit for about 10 minutes before serving.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ully!

Variations of Cucumber Sweet Pepper Salad

One of the things I adore about the Cucumber Sweet Pepper Salad is its flexibility. You can easily switch things up to suit your taste or the season. Here are a few variations that I’ve tried and loved:

  • Mexican Twist: Add black beans, corn, and a sprinkle of cumin for a zesty, southwestern flair. A squeeze of lime juice elevates the flavors even more!
  • Asian Inspiration: Toss in some shredded carrots and edamame, and dress it with sesame oil and rice vinegar. A sprinkle of sesame seeds on top adds a delightful crunch.
  • Herbed Delight: Experiment with different herbs like mint or cilantro instead of parsley. They bring a fresh, aromatic quality that’s simply irresistible.
  • Grain Bowl: For a heartier option, mix in cooked quinoa or farro. This turns the salad into a filling meal, perfect for lunch or dinner.

Frequently Asked Questions about Cucumber Sweet Pepper Salad

As I’ve shared my love for the Cucumber Sweet Pepper Salad, I often get questions from friends and family eager to try it out. It’s always a joy to help others discover the magic of this vibrant dish! Here are some of the most common questions I receive, along with my answers to help you on your culinary journey.

Can I make the salad ahead of time?

Absolutely! You can prepare the vegetables a few hours in advance and store them in an airtight container in the fridge. Just wait to add the dressing until you’re ready to serve. This keeps the salad fresh and crunchy!

What can I substitute for feta cheese?

If feta isn’t your thing, you can try crumbled goat cheese or even a dairy-free cheese alternative. For a nutty flavor, toasted sunflower seeds or chopped nuts can also be a great addition!

How long will leftovers last?

While I recommend enjoying the salad fresh, leftovers can be stored in the fridge for up to two days. Just keep in mind that the cucumbers may release water, so the salad might become a bit watery over time.

Can I add protein to the salad?

Definitely! Adding grilled chicken, shrimp, or chickpeas can turn this salad into a satisfying meal. It’s a great way to make it more filling while still keeping it light and refreshing.

Is this salad suitable for meal prep?

Yes! The Cucumber Sweet Pepper Salad is perfect for meal prep. Just prepare the ingredients and store them separately. When you’re ready to eat, mix them together with the dressing for a quick and healthy meal!
